About Us

At Connecting Staff, we are a dedicated support work company providing personalised, one-on-one support to children, young people, and adults living with a disability. Our team of experienced support workers help participants build independence, access the community, and reach their NDIS goals — all while feeling safe, respected, and understood.

 

We know that every person is unique, so we take the time to understand each individual’s needs, preferences, and aspirations. Whether it’s helping at home, getting out and about, or developing new skills, our support is flexible and built around you.

 

We also work closely with families, allied health professionals, and services to ensure a strong circle of support. As a non-registered NDIS provider, we work with self-managed and plan-managed participants across Victoria.

Psychosocial

Psychosocial Support Icon.png

We understand that living with a psychosocial disability can make it challenging to participate fully in everyday life. Our in-house psychosocial support sessions provide a safe, supportive space for participants to build life skills, work on personal goals, and increase confidence, without the need for clinical therapy.

Retreats

Our Short Term Accommodation provides participants with a one-on-one getaway designed to support goal development in a new and engaging environment. This support offers a break from everyday routines and promotes skill-building, social participation, and increased independence — all while enjoying fun and meaningful experiences with a familiar support worker.

SIL Support

At Connecting Staff, our aim is to provide SIL supports that feel calm, respectful, consistent and centred around the individual, helping them thrive independently. We understand that home is a personal space, and the right support should help participants feel safe, comfortable, listened to and in control of their daily life.

Activities

Activities icon.png

We provide a wide range of individualised supports and activities to help participants achieve their NDIS goals and live more independently. Our services include school holiday programs, Saturday night social groups, one-on-one support, and outreach assistance to access your local community, as well as other flexible options tailored to your needs.
